2006 Dodge Ram vs. 2004 Ford Focus

To start off, 2006 Dodge Ram is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Ford Focus.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Ford Focus would be higher. At 5,881 cc (8 cylinders), 2006 Dodge Ram is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Dodge Ram (325 HP @ 2900 RPM) has 181 more horse power than 2004 Ford Focus. (144 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Dodge Ram should accelerate faster than 2004 Ford Focus.

Let's talk about torque, 2006 Dodge Ram (827 Nm) has 625 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Ford Focus. (202 Nm). This means 2006 Dodge Ram will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Ford Focus.
